Punt Hill Copper-Gold Project
Olympic Iron-Oxide Copper-Gold ± Uranium Province
-
Extends for 700km along eastern margin of the Gawler Craton
-
Hosts 3 significant deposits
– Olympic Dam 8,330 Mt @ 0.88% Cu, 0.028% U3O8, 0.31g/t Au & 1.5g/t Ag
Prominent Hill – 152 Mt @ 1.18% Cu, 0.48g/t Au, 2.92g/t Ag
Carrapateena – no resource yet , reported intersection 905m at 2.1 % Cu and 1.0 g/t Au
• New discoveries at Hillside (Rex Minerals) and Cairn Hill (IMX Resources) may also be part of the IOCG family of deposits •IOCG ± U deposits are commonly associated with long-lived tectonic zones, resulting in highly endowed mineralised provinces (Examples include the Peruvian and Chile deposits of South America and the Great Bear Magmatic Zone in Canada)

Punt Hill Copper-Gold Project
Groundhog Prospect
-
7 holes drilled to date – incl. 159m @ 0.47% Cu, 5.3 g/t Ag, 0.12 g/t Au, 0.48% Zn & 0.12% Pb
-
Residual gravity anomaly with strong NW with lesser SE structural control
-
Late IOCG style alteration and mineralisation
-
Early oxidised gold skarn style alteration
-
Replacement style mineralisation but potential high grade structurally controlled zones
-
Sedimentary, volcanic and granite host

Punt Hill Copper-Gold Project
New GHDD2 Results
-
GHDD2 ended in >1% Cu
-
The drill hole was extended from 901m to 1069m in the last round of drilling
-
New results include:
162m @ 0.34% Cu from 888m to 1050m
(Including 28m @ 0.7% Cu from 897m to 925m)
151m @ 0.38% Zn from 899m to 1050m

Punt Hill Copper-Gold Project
Summary
-
•Confirmed two very large IOCG ± U mineralisation and alteration systems up to 8 x 2 km across.
-
•Confirmed IOCG ± U style of alteration (hematite-sideriteamphibole-chlorite-fluorite)
-
•Confirmed IOCG ± U style mineralisation (bornitechalcopyrite)
-
•Punt Hill located within major IOCG ± U Province near significant discovery at Carrapateena
